Key findings
Tribunal's reasoningThe respondent company was in compulsory liquidation. The tribunal recorded that the claimant was told on 1 February 2023 that he had to apply to the court for permission to continue the proceedings, but he did not provide evidence that any such application had been made.
On 17 April 2024 the tribunal gave the claimant an opportunity to provide written reasons by 24 April 2024, or to request a hearing, to address why the claim should not be struck out. The claimant did not give an acceptable reason and did not request a hearing.
The tribunal therefore struck out the claim under rule 37 of the Employment Tribunals Rules of Procedure 2013, specifically rule 37(1)(d), on the basis that the claim had not been actively pursued.
